Output 4a0951607954d1a6752eb7f64e6c248f579f23f852e11f17bcbae10269f17998:1

value
1384214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17c4a5c27fa0639304e67dc72cd869f437cebe24 OP_EQUALVERIFY OP_CHECKSIG
address
13Ag7ikdxXWCdhYN6ZgEnocaPgvpSbr23S
transaction
4a0951607954d1a6752eb7f64e6c248f579f23f852e11f17bcbae10269f17998
spent
true